Ghee Chuan Lai is a scholar working on Molecular Biology, Genetics and Biophysics. According to data from OpenAlex, Ghee Chuan Lai has authored 5 papers receiving a total of 363 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Molecular Biology, 3 papers in Genetics and 2 papers in Biophysics. Recurrent topics in Ghee Chuan Lai's work include Bacterial Genetics and Biotechnology (3 papers), Gut microbiota and health (2 papers) and Plant and fungal interactions (1 paper). Ghee Chuan Lai is often cited by papers focused on Bacterial Genetics and Biotechnology (3 papers), Gut microbiota and health (2 papers) and Plant and fungal interactions (1 paper). Ghee Chuan Lai collaborates with scholars based in United States, Colombia and Singapore. Ghee Chuan Lai's co-authors include Norman Pavelka, Tze Guan Tan, Hongbaek Cho, Thomas G. Bernhardt, Jose Antonio Reales‐Calderón, Marina Yurieva, Giulia Rancati, Kandhadayar G. Srinivasan, Alrina Tan and Xiaohui Sem and has published in prestigious journals such as Science, Nature Communications and Nature Protocols.

All Works

5 of 5 papers shown
1.
Tso, Gloria Hoi Wan, Jose Antonio Reales‐Calderón, Alrina Tan, et al.. (2018). Experimental evolution of a fungal pathogen into a gut symbiont. Science. 362(6414). 589–595. 179 indexed citations
2.
Lai, Ghee Chuan, Tze Guan Tan, & Norman Pavelka. (2018). The mammalian mycobiome: A complex system in a dynamic relationship with the host. WIREs Systems Biology and Medicine. 11(1). e1438–e1438. 57 indexed citations
3.
Lai, Ghee Chuan, Hongbaek Cho, & Thomas G. Bernhardt. (2017). The mecillinam resistome reveals a role for peptidoglycan endopeptidases in stimulating cell wall synthesis in Escherichia coli. PLoS Genetics. 13(7). e1006934–e1006934. 66 indexed citations
4.
Okumuş, Burak, Charles J. Baker, Ghee Chuan Lai, et al.. (2017). Single-cell microscopy of suspension cultures using a microfluidics-assisted cell screening platform. Nature Protocols. 13(1). 170–194. 22 indexed citations
5.
Okumuş, Burak, Dirk Landgraf, Ghee Chuan Lai, et al.. (2016). Mechanical slowing-down of cytoplasmic diffusion allows in vivo counting of proteins in individual cells. Nature Communications. 7(1). 11641–11641. 39 indexed citations
